在电子商城的运营过程中,一份清晰、详细的需求文档是确保项目顺利进行的关键。它不仅是团队沟通的桥梁,也是项目执行的指南。那么,如何撰写一份实用且高效的需求文档呢?以下是一些详细的步骤和技巧。
一、明确文档目的
在开始撰写之前,首先要明确需求文档的目的。是为了产品开发、功能迭代,还是为了团队协作?明确目的有助于后续内容的组织和撰写。
二、了解用户需求
深入了解用户需求是撰写需求文档的基础。可以通过以下方式获取:
- 用户访谈:与目标用户进行面对面交流,了解他们的痛点和需求。
- 用户调研:通过问卷调查、用户行为分析等方式,收集用户数据。
- 市场调研:分析竞争对手的产品,找出差异化和创新点。
三、梳理业务流程
将电子商城的业务流程梳理清楚,包括用户注册、浏览商品、下单支付、售后服务等环节。梳理流程有助于发现潜在的问题,并为后续的功能设计提供参考。
四、制定功能需求
根据用户需求和业务流程,制定详细的功能需求。以下是一些常见的功能需求:
- 用户管理:注册、登录、修改个人信息、找回密码等。
- 商品管理:商品分类、商品信息、库存管理、促销活动等。
- 订单管理:订单查询、订单处理、物流跟踪等。
- 售后服务:退换货、投诉处理、售后服务咨询等。
五、撰写技术需求
针对功能需求,详细描述技术实现方案。包括:
- 技术选型:数据库、前端框架、后端语言等。
- 系统架构:系统模块划分、数据流向、接口定义等。
- 性能优化:响应时间、并发处理、系统稳定性等。
六、制定验收标准
明确验收标准,确保项目质量。以下是一些常见的验收标准:
- 功能完整性:所有功能均能正常使用。
- 界面友好性:界面美观、操作便捷。
- 性能稳定性:系统运行流畅,无卡顿、死机等现象。
- 安全性:数据传输加密,防止信息泄露。
七、编写文档结构
一份完整的需求文档应包含以下部分:
- 封面:文档标题、版本号、编写人、日期等。
- 目录:文档结构概览。
- 摘要:简要介绍文档内容。
- 引言:背景、目的、适用范围等。
- 用户需求分析:用户调研、市场分析等。
- 业务流程:电子商城业务流程图。
- 功能需求:详细描述功能需求。
- 技术需求:技术实现方案。
- 验收标准:项目验收标准。
- 附录:相关资料、图表等。
八、反复修订
在撰写过程中,要不断与团队成员、用户沟通,根据反馈意见进行修订。确保文档内容准确、完整、易于理解。
九、分享与维护
将需求文档分享给团队成员,确保每个人都了解项目需求。同时,随着项目进展,及时更新文档内容,保持文档的时效性。
通过以上步骤,相信您已经能够撰写一份实用且高效的需求文档。这将有助于电子商城项目的顺利进行,提升运营效果。
